The Heritage Alliance is the biggest alliance of heritage interests in the UK and was set up to promote the central role of the independent movement in the heritage sector. The Heritage Alliance aims to advocate by identifying the overarching messages from our members and putting them across to opinion formers and decision makers in England. The Alliance also aims to advocate broader issues such a

s the importance of heritage to national prosperity and wellbeing, alongside the importance of generating new thinking and dialogue on heritage issues. It aims to share by drawing on membersโ€™ experience and expertise to influence legislation, policy and guidance; by supporting collaborative working and information-sharing between Alliance members; and by exploring new patterns of engagement to deepen understanding and commitment. It builds capacity amongst members to champion and engage with heritage through events and on-line resources; by taking forward initiatives to strengthen the financial resilience of the independent heritage sector; and by promoting and embracing partnership opportunities. The Heritage alliance also develops its members by achieving greater representation by heritage groups; by refreshing and developing information-sharing devices such as the Advocacy Groups, Heritage Update, website and social media; and by increasing and diversifying funding for core costs, including corporate and individual support.

It is fantastic to see our Trainee for Wales, and Heritage Trust Network Youth Forum member, Izabella Maar at The Heritage Alliance debate today. Izzy talked about the lack of graduate schemes or graduate-specific opportunities in the sector and the lack of progression once you have secured that first role.

Heritage Trust Network currently has 3 graduate trainees who are paid a living wage. What is your organisation doing to provide opportunities for young people entering the sector?
